    Swing You Sinners! is a 1930 animated cartoon short, directed by the Fleischer Brothers as part of the Talkartoons series.

    Warner Brothers did a tribute to the Fleischer "moving background" trope in an episode of Animaniacs. Yakko, Wakko and Dot find themselves on a street where everything is black and white and the buildings have eyes, and they even comment on it.
    That whole bit about the character getting trapped in a surreal setting where none of the laws of nature work (not even to the extent that they work in the "normal" cartoon universe) is what makes the whole "descent into Toontown" sequence in "Who Framed Roger Rabbit" work.

    It actually does have a story, not an important one but if you listen to the lyrics some ghosts say “You’ll never rob another hen house” “Chickens you used to steal” “Craps you used to shoot” “Girls you used to chase” and more, This cartoon was directed towards children, to teach them what not to do, especially during the Great Depression where the world was suffering and danger was very high
